Dr. Tarik Hasan, MD is an internist in Tampa, FL and has over 35 years of experience in the medical field. He graduated from Universidad De Panama, Facultad De Medicina in 1986. He is affiliated with HCA Florida Trinity Hospital. With over 35 years of dedicated experience in Internal Medicine care, he brings a wealth of clinical knowledge and compassionate care to his patients and their families. His medical education includes residency training in Internal Medicine at Woodhull Med Mntl Health Center, further refining his skills in comprehensive medical care, particularly for older adults. He is Board Certified in Internal Medicine by the American Board of Internal Medicine. He is accepting new patients. Effective management of health is key to well-being in later life. Dr. Tarik Hasan provides expert, compassionate care for a range of conditions common in older adults, with a focus on managing symptoms and maintaining function. Common areas of focus include:
- Arthritis: Arthritis is a common condition causing joint pain and stiffness, often manageable with medication, physical therapy, and lifestyle changes to maintain mobility and independence.
- Tobacco Use Disorder: Tobacco use disorder is a condition where someone struggles to quit smoking or using tobacco despite wanting to, and it can be managed with support and treatment to improve their health and well-being.
- Bedsores: With careful attention and treatment, bedsores can heal, reducing discomfort and restoring your ability to engage in activities that matter to you.
- Insomnia: Experiencing insomnia means struggling to get enough restful sleep, which can leave you feeling tired and irritable during the day; however, many effective strategies and medical interventions are available to help improve your sleep.
- Acidosis: Acidosis is a medical condition affecting your body's acid levels, sometimes causing symptoms like nausea or breathing difficulty; working with your healthcare provider can lead to better symptom control and a higher quality of life.
- Mycobacterial Lung Infection: Similar to tuberculosis, a mycobacterial lung infection is a bacterial infection in your lungs, which can be managed effectively with a course of antibiotics to aid recovery and maintain your independence.
- Hypotension: Feeling faint or weak might be due to hypotension, a condition where your blood pressure is too low, but a tailored treatment plan can help you feel stronger and more energetic.
- Anemia: Anemia is a common condition, especially in older adults, characterized by low red blood cell count; thankfully, various treatments are available to help restore energy levels and enhance overall well-being.
- Gastroesophageal Reflux Disease (GERD): GERD is when stomach acid irritates the esophagus, leading to burning sensations and other issues, but with your doctor's help, through medication or dietary adjustments, you can often find relief and improve your quality of life.
- Hyperlipidemia: Hyperlipidemia, or high cholesterol, is a condition where you have too much fat in your blood, which can increase your risk of heart disease, but with proper diet and medication, you can keep your heart healthy and maintain your active lifestyle.
- Painful Urination (Dysuria): Dysuria, or painful urination, is often easily managed with medication or lifestyle changes prescribed by your doctor, making it less disruptive to your daily routine.
- Atherosclerosis: Atherosclerosis is a condition where plaque builds up inside your arteries, narrowing them and reducing blood flow, which can be managed with lifestyle changes and medication to improve your heart health and energy levels.

To provide comprehensive and person-centered care, Dr. Tarik Hasan offers a range of services designed to diagnose, manage, and support the health of older adults:
- Arterial Blood Gas Test (ABG): This simple blood test helps assess your blood's acid-base balance, crucial for managing conditions like ch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D).
- Care Coordination for Complex Conditions and Procedures: Care coordination helps seniors with multiple health issues manage their conditions effectively by connecting them with the right specialists and resources.
- Electrocardiogram (EKG): An EKG is a vital tool in monitoring the effectiveness of your heart medication and adjusting your treatment plan as needed, optimizing your heart health and overall quality of life.
- Fecal Occult Blood Test for Colorectal Cancer: A fecal occult blood test is a simple screening tool that can help detect hidden blood in your stool, an early sign that might indicate colorectal cancer.
- Immunization Administration: Regular immunization updates ensure that seniors' immune systems are adequately prepared to fight infections, significantly contributing to their quality of life.
- Allergy Immunology Care: Allergy immunology services provide a comprehensive assessment of your allergies, leading to a personalized treatment plan to minimize discomfort and maintain your well-being.
- Pharmacologic Stress Testing: If you experience chest pain or shortness of breath, pharmacologic stress testing can help diagnose the cause by safely stressing your heart and revealing any underlying issues.
